A urine test is performed to detect the presence of the hormone human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G) in a woman's urine. hCG is produced after a fertilized egg attaches to the uterus, typically detected within 10 to 14 days of conception.
Std Sti Testing
Medical testing to detect infections like chlamydia, gonorrhea, syphilis, HIV, or herpes. Testing may involve blood, urine, or swab samples to confirm an infection and guide next steps in care.
